1. 首页
  2. 课程学习
  3. Java
  4. 深入了解Canal及其应用指南

深入了解Canal及其应用指南

上传者: 2023-12-08 00:33:58上传 RAR文件 370.45MB 热度 64次

Canal是一款开源的数据库同步工具,主要用于实时同步数据库变更到其他数据存储系统。它支持多种数据库管理系统,包括MySQL、MariaDB、Percona等。Canal的设计理念是通过数据库的日志解析来获取变更,然后将这些变更传递给其他数据存储系统,实现数据同步。这种实时同步的方式使得Canal在数据迁移、数据备份和实时分析等场景下得到广泛应用。

使用Canal可以轻松实现数据库之间的异构数据同步,保证数据的一致性。同时,Canal提供了丰富的配置选项,使得用户可以根据实际需求进行定制化设置。在配置过程中,用户可以指定需要同步的数据库、表,以及过滤不同类型的操作,灵活性很高。

关于Canal的使用,首先需要安装和配置Canal Server,然后在需要同步的数据库上部署Canal Client。Canal Server负责解析数据库的日志,并将变更发送给订阅的客户端。Canal Client接收变更并将其应用到目标存储系统中,实现数据同步。

总的来说,Canal作为一款可靠、高效的数据库同步工具,为用户提供了强大的数据同步能力,使得数据在不同存储系统之间流动变得更加轻松。

下载地址
用户评论